Runbook: Glyphsorter encoding detection, release checks. Before promoting a build, upload the mixed-encoding sample set and confirm UTF-8, Latin-1, and Shift-style fallbacks all classify correctly. A misdetection blocks release — no exceptions. Detection thresholds are environment-specific; the detector must be started with the values below.

config for kafof-bawef:
holath:
  log_level: debug
  metrics_host: metrics.holath.qorvelsys.internal
  pin: 2191
  pool_size: 32

Changelog 3.2.0 — Fernhaus greenhouse controller. Renamed DRIFT_COMP_SECRET to SENSOR_DRIFT_CAL_KEY since it's actually the calibration-service credential, not a generic secret (sorry, reviewers). Old name still works until 3.4 but logs a warning. The drift correction job refuses to start without it, so in each env file the new entry should appear right after this note.

vault entry, fawip-kageg: RELAY_SECRET20=bdc404df98d1e5f35869

- [ ] **Step 7: Breaker override escrow.** After sealing the signing keys for the Tallgrove upstream API circuit breaker, confirm the support team can force the breaker open during a full outage. The override bundle lives in the sealed escrow drawer and is useless without its unlock phrase. Two ceremony witnesses must initial this step before proceeding. The escrow bundle is decrypted with the recovery passphrase that follows.

vault phrase of kahip-kahop = holath-quenmir

Handover — Pictoloft Image Cache Leak

The thumbnail cache in Pictoloft leaks roughly 200MB per day because evicted entries keep decoder handles alive. A nightly restart masks it; the real fix is in review. Please watch heap metrics after any deploy. The cache and restart schedule are governed by the configuration below.

settings of tajep-tafog:
CASDOR_LOG_LEVEL=info
CASDOR_METRICS_HOST=metrics.casdor.nelvrosys.internal
CASDOR_POOL_SIZE=16